Have we ever heard a harbour master say he doesn't want tugs with more bollard pull? Or an oil company knocks back an anchor-handler because of too much bollard pull? Unlikely. With bollard pulls approaching 300 tonnes, do we really appreciate the relevance of these figures? How much more do we need? Is 400 tonnes the limit? Is there a disconnect between theoretical calculations and practical seamanship? Are empirical bollard pull formulae causing confusion? Can too much bollard pull be dangerous? This paper examines the history of bollard pulls and the impact on our industry today - the myths and confusion and even the misguided emphasis placed on bollard pulls.
